摘 要
利用了现代科技手段,将传统的小学数学教育与游戏娱乐相结合,为孩子们创造了一个更加轻松、有趣的学习环境。通过游戏化的方式,孩子们能够在玩乐中掌握数学知识,提升逻辑思维能力,激发学习兴趣。这种寓教于乐的学习方式不仅能够减轻孩子们的学习压力,还能有效提高学习效果,为他们今后的学习和成长打下坚实的基础。同时,这类App还方便孩子们随时随地进行数学学习,使学习不再受时间和地点的限制。
本文首先概述了小学数学教育的发展趋势以及智能化技术在小学数学教育领域的应用现状,指出了传统小学数学教育模式面临的挑战和在线教学的潜在优势。该系统采用Java作为后台编程语言,MySQL作为数据库,结合App开发模式进行设计。实现了游戏视频的管理、数学游戏答题管理,为教师和学生提供了更加便捷、高效的学习体验。最后,论文总结了基于Android的小学数学游戏App的优势与不足,并提出了未来发展和改进的方向。该平台将在提升小学数学教学质量、促进教育公平和推动教育改革方面发挥越来越重要的作用。
关键词:在线教学;App;MySQL;小学数学
Abstract
By utilizing modern technological means, traditional primary school mathematics education has been combined with gaming and entertainment, creating a more relaxed and fun learning environment for children. Through gamification, children can master mathematical knowledge, improve logical thinking ability, and stimulate learning interest through play. This learning method that combines education with entertainment not only reduces children's learning pressure, but also effectively improves learning outcomes, laying a solid foundation for their future learning and growth. At the same time, these apps also facilitate children's math learning anytime, anywhere, making learning no longer limited by time and location.
This article first outlines the development trend of primary school mathematics education and the application status of intelligent technology in the field of primary school mathematics education, pointing out the challenges faced by traditional primary school mathematics education models and the potential advantages of online teaching. The system adopts Java as the backend programming language, MySQL as the database, and is designed in combination with the App development mode. Implemented the management of game videos and math game quizzes, providing teachers and students with a more convenient and efficient learning experience. Finally, the paper summarizes the advantages and disadvantages of an Android based primary school mathematics game app, and proposes directions for future development and improvement. This platform will play an increasingly important role in improving the quality of primary school mathematics teaching, promoting educational equity, and promoting educational reform.
Keywords:online teaching; App; MySQL; Primary school mathematics
目 录
摘 要 I
Abstract I
1 绪论 1
1.1 课题研究的背景 1
1.2 课题研究的意义 1
1.3 国内外研究现状 2
1.4 论文组织结构 3
1.5 本章小结 3
2 系统开发技术 4
2.1 Android技术 4
2.2 SSM框架 5
2.3 MySQL数据库 5
2.4 本章小结 6
3 需求分析 7
3.1 可行性分析 7
3.1.1 经济可行性 7
3.1.2 技术可行性 7
3.1.3 操作可行性 7
3.1.4 社会可行性 7
3.2 功能性需求分析 8
3.2.1 管理员用户需求分析 8
3.2.2 教师用户需求分析 10
3.2.3 学生用户需求分析 11
3.3 本章小结 13
4 系统设计 14
4.1 系统结构设计 14
4.2 系统功能设计 15
4.3 数据库设计 16
4.3.1 E-R图 17
4.3.2 数据库结构 17
4.4 本章小结 24
5 系统实现 25
5.1管理员端功能实现 25
5.1.1管理员登录功能实现 25
5.1.2教师信息管理功能 25
5.1.3学生信息管理功能 26
5.1.4公告信息管理功能 27
5.1.5数学游戏视频管理功能 27
5.2教师端功能实现 28
5.2.1我的题库管理功能 28
5.2.2考试管理功能 29
5.2.3往期成绩信息管理功能 30
5.3App功能实现 30
5.3.1app首页界面 30
5.3.2游戏视频查看 31
5.3.3个人信息维护 32
5.3.4自测答题功能 32
5.3.5我的自测成绩功能 32
6 系统测试 34
6.1 测试目的 34
6.2 测试用例 34
6.3 测试结论 36
7 总结和展望 37
7.1 总结 37
7.2 展望 37
致 谢 38
参考文献 39
基于Android的小学数学游戏App包括基础信息管理、系统管理、游戏视频管理、教师管理、学生管理、题目管理、考试管理、成绩管理等模块。系统用户分为管理员、教师和学生三种角色。
一、学生端功能设计
做题功能:学生可以在游戏化的界面中完成数学题目,题目类型丰富多样,旨在激发学生的学习兴趣和思维能力。系统会即时反馈答题结果,帮助学生及时纠正错误。
回顾往期成绩功能:学生可以查看自己的历史成绩记录,包括每次做题的时间、得分情况等,帮助他们了解自己的学习进度和变化趋势,从而调整学习策略。
错题回顾功能:系统会根据学生的答题情况,自动整理出学生的错题集。学生可以随时查看错题,并查阅详细的解析和练习,加深对知识点的理解和记忆。
查看数学游戏视频功能:学生可以在App内观看与数学相关的游戏视频,这些视频既可以是教学视频,也可以是趣味性的数学游戏介绍,旨在拓展学生的数学视野,提高他们的学习兴趣。
二、教师端功能设计
建立并发布题库功能:教师可以根据教学需求,自主创建和编辑数学题目,并发布到题库中。题库支持不断更新和扩充,以满足不同年级和教学内容的需求。
查看学生成绩功能:教师可以随时查看学生的做题成绩,包括得分、答题时间等详细数据。通过对这些数据的分析,教师可以了解学生的学习情况,发现存在的问题,从而进行有针对性的教学指导。
三、管理端功能设计
后台管理功能:管理员可以对App的所有表格进行后台管理,包括用户数据、成绩记录、视频资源等。通过后台管理,管理员可以确保数据的准确性和安全性,维护App的正常运行。
学生与教师信息管理功能:管理员可以管理学生和教师的注册信息、权限设置等,确保用户信息的完整性和一致性。同时,管理员还可以根据学生的学习情况和教师的需求,调整用户权限和设置,提供更个性化的服务。
数学游戏视频与资讯信息管理功能:管理员可以上传、编辑和删除数学游戏视频和资讯信息,确保App内容的时效性和丰富性。通过定期更新内容,管理员可以为学生提供最新、最优质的学习资源,激发他们的学习兴趣和热情。